Transaction 99a2c9dea25fea97ebff73a2e6be9588c3175ea28132ece84ab0e097147d04e9

69 Input
2 Outputs
  • 99a2c9dea25fea97ebff73a2e6be9588c3175ea28132ece84ab0e097147d04e9:0
  • value  28612000
    address  1D86jzbC3YUdC6RpJnqogMZsSWiYRbPzsh
  • 99a2c9dea25fea97ebff73a2e6be9588c3175ea28132ece84ab0e097147d04e9:1
  • value  127946
    address  37VVvzEuvvZrveD8kQbAYL72otVqXNqT8u